What Is Agentic AI in Project Management?

Agentic AI in project management is an advanced AI system capable of independently managing project tasks and making data-driven decisions without requiring continuous human intervention.

In other words, it is not simply a traditional chatbot or a tool that only responds to user requests and waits for commands.

Instead, it operates proactively by analyzing data and automatically executing actions based on predefined objectives

Within the context of project management, an intelligent agent can monitor project progress, analyze timelines, and optimize resource allocation, functioning as a digital team member. 

It collects information from management tools (such as +P for project management) and processes it in real time.

As a result, organizations can reduce routine manual work and minimize the errors associated with it. 

Unlike traditional systems that require continuous guidance, Agentic AI demonstrates a high level of autonomy by proactively responding in alignment with the organization’s overall context and supporting strategic objectives.

Therefore, Agentic AI is considered an ideal solution for intelligent project management. 

It combines the capabilities of a smart virtual assistant with advanced data analytics capabilities, enabling advanced analysis and intelligent decision-making that distinguish it from traditional chatbots.

1. Predicting Risks Before They Occur

The intelligent system can analyze performance indicators, project timelines, and resource utilization in real time, then identify the possibility of task delays or budget overruns before they become actual problems. 

This enables project managers to take proactive corrective actions that minimize losses and keep projects on track.

2. Automating Routine and Repetitive Tasks

Agentic AI automates numerous daily processes, including updating project timelines, generating progress reports, sending notifications, and monitoring task execution. 

This reduces the administrative workload on teams and allows them to dedicate more time and focus to strategic decision-making.

3. Real-Time Analytics

Agentic AI systems process data instantly and transform it into clear insights that help management accurately understand project status.

Instead of waiting for weekly reports, managers can access real-time updates that support faster and more accurate decision-making.

4. Enhancing Decision-Making with Greater Intelligence 

The intelligent agent not only identifies problems, but it also recommends practical, data-driven solutions, such as reallocating resources, adjusting task priorities, or recommending corrective action plans (CAP – Corrective Action Plans) to improve performance and accelerate project delivery.

5. Continuous Learning and Performance Improvement Over Time

Some intelligent systems use reinforcement learning techniques to continuously improve their performance. 

They learn from previous outcomes, team behaviors, and historical project data, then automatically refine their decision-making approach over time.

6. Strengthening Collaboration Across Teams

Agentic AI helps unify communication between departments and execution teams by coordinating tasks, tracking decisions, and delivering intelligent updates and notifications.

This reduces misunderstandings and improves collaboration efficiency throughout the project lifecycle.

7. Increasing Productivity and Reducing Human Errors

By leveraging automation and intelligent analytics, organizations can reduce reliance on manual data entry and traditional follow-ups. 

This improves team efficiency, minimizes errors, and accelerates project completion while delivering higher-quality project outcomes.

1. Automating Routine and Repetitive Tasks

Agentic AI automates routine administrative tasks, such as updating project timelines and generating regular progress reports. 

Practical Example: The agent continuously monitors task progress and generates status reports directly within the project dashboard, saving project managers hours of daily work.

This means repetitive activities, such as data entry or sending notifications, can be completed without human intervention. 

As a result, manual errors are reduced, ensuring information remains consistent while team members are freed to focus on strategic work.

In practical applications, teams can save valuable time by automating monitoring and follow-up activities, allowing them to dedicate more effort to innovation and solving complex problems.

2. Real-Time Data Analysis

Agentic AI performs real-time data analysis to support strategic decision-making. 

AI connects different tools, such as scheduling platforms and data repositories, to create a comprehensive view of current project performance. 

Example: The agent processes Key Performance Indicators (KPIs) as they become available, quickly identifies abnormal patterns, and provides real-time predictions about the project trajectory.

Through this approach, large volumes of fragmented data are transformed into clear, actionable insights that help leaders make immediate and informed decisions. 

As a result, project management becomes driven by accurate and continuously updated information rather than relying on weekly or manually prepared reports.

3. Predicting Risks and Issues Before They Occur

Agentic AI stands out for its ability to identify and highlight potential project risks before they occur. 

AI analyzes live indicators and historical data comprehensively to determine when and where delays or budget overruns may occur. 

Through this approach, it shifts project management from a reactive problem-solving model to a proactive prevention model.

Instead of discovering issues after they occur, the intelligent agent predicts multiple scenarios and recommends early corrective actions. 

💡 Practical Insight: If the agent detects a continuous increase in delays within a critical task, it automatically sends an alert with recommendations to reallocate resources or adjust the project timeline before the issue escalates and impacts project execution.

How to Choose the Right Intelligent System for Project Management?

Choosing the right intelligent system for project management is not only about the number of features or the strength of the technology.

It depends on the system’s ability to align with your organization’s needs, support teams effectively, and deliver real-world results.

A successful system helps accelerate project delivery, improve decision-making, and reduce operational risks, not merely a tool for managing tasks or displaying reports.

With the rapid growth of Agentic AI solutions, Saudi organizations now require intelligent systems that combine security, ease of use, seamless integration with existing platforms, and the ability to support local business environments in alignment with digital transformation requirements and Vision 2030.

Before adopting any intelligent project management system, organizations should focus on several key criteria to ensure they select the solution that best meets their operational needs:

1. Integration Capability

The system should be able to integrate seamlessly with existing tools, including project management platforms, ERP systems, KPI platforms, email systems, and digital meeting solutions within the organization. 

Seamless integration ensures unified data flow and prevents information fragmentation across different systems.

2. Ease of Use and User Experience

Regardless of how advanced the technology is, a complex user interface or difficult usability can limit adoption and reduce effectiveness. 

Therefore, it is important to choose a system with an intuitive interface, clear dashboards, and full Arabic language support to help teams adopt the platform quickly and efficiently.

3. Security and Data Sovereignty

Data protection is one of the most critical factors when selecting AI solutions for Saudi organizations. 

The system must comply with cybersecurity requirements and local regulatory standards, especially when handling sensitive data and strategic projects, including the requirements of the following:

Designed to align with Saudi digital security and governance standards

🇸🇦 SDAIA 🏦 SAMA 🔐 NCA

4. Analytical and Predictive Capabilities

A truly intelligent system should not only display information but also provide advanced data analysis, risk prediction capabilities, and proactive alerts that help management make faster and more accurate decisions.

5. Technical Support and Continuous Development

It is essential to select a solution provider that offers responsive technical support, regular updates, and continuous system improvements. 

AI systems evolve rapidly, and a lack of continuous development can negatively impact organizational efficiency in the future.

6. Ability to Test Before Full Adoption

One of the best practices is to conduct a pilot project on a small project or within a specific department. 

This step helps evaluate the system’s actual performance, measure team adoption, and identify potential challenges before full-scale implementation.

7. Alignment with Organizational Goals and Strategy

The system should not be viewed as merely an operational tool but as a core component of the organization’s digital transformation and performance improvement strategy.

The ideal solution is one that connects project management, key performance indicators (KPIs), and strategic objectives within a unified intelligent platform.
